Output 9383810b0ae072b5426a24dd4c4e687869cbd1b0dd929957aa140c5de62eba51:2

value
389950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f6c8a4edfb5df03a8b589387485b1e29f173df OP_EQUAL
address
3KTtebVjU4ya8dQZe6WwRoYSaBNKmGdJmk
transaction
9383810b0ae072b5426a24dd4c4e687869cbd1b0dd929957aa140c5de62eba51
spent
true